What you’ll study

This program is delivered on campus and online, with some in-person attendance required for assessments. As a student, you'll complete three core coursework subjects, developing vital professional skills and building your knowledge of contemporary legal practice.
 
You'll also undertake a practical work placement, where you'll apply your theoretical understanding in a real legal environment, building valuable professional experience. As a graduate, you’ll meet both the educational and practical requirements to apply to the Supreme Court of NSW for registration as a practising lawyer.

Typical course program

The outline below shows an example program for the Graduate Certificate in Professional Legal Practice based on a full-time study load. Please note that your exact program may differ based on your unique circumstances, such as your commencement date, subject selections and recognition of prior learning (RPL).

Course structure

  1. 3
    core subjects
  2. 1
    Law elective (for non-law graduates only)
  3. 1
    practical work experience
  1. First year

    You’ll build a vital understanding of transactions, litigation and estate law, along with critical legal and professional skills, before completing up to 13 weeks of hands-on learning in a professional placement. Students without a law degree complete an additional elective.
